Soffit and Fascia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ide<br>Soffit and fascia | Soffit and Fascia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ide<br>Soffit and fascia might not be the first terms that come to mind when house owners think of their homes, however they play important functions in both aesthetics and performance. Gradually, these parts of your roofline can end up being used or harmed due to weather, insects, or simple age. This article will check out the significance of soffit and fascia, factors for replacement, the replacement process, and frequently asked questions.<br>Understanding Soffit and Fascia<br>Before diving into replacement information, it's essential to comprehend what soffit and fascia are.<br>What is Soffit?<br>Soffit refers to the underside of the [http://www.eruyi.cn/space-uid-335718.html Eaves Maintenance] or overhanging sections of your roofing. It is often aerated, enabling air blood circulation into the attic and protecting the roofing system from moisture buildup, which can cause mold growth and rot.<br>What is Fascia?<br>Fascia is the horizontal board that runs along the edge of the roofing system. It serves as a barrier in between the roof and the outdoors elements, offering support for the lower roofline and acting as a mounting point for gutters.<br>Table 1: Functions of Soffit and FasciaPartFunctionSoffit- Ventilates the attic to prevent moisture buildup<br>- Protects rafters from weather damage<br>- Enhances the visual appeal of the homeFascia- Supports the edge of the roofing system<br>- Serves as a base for seamless gutters<br>- Provides aesthetic attract the rooflineReasons for Replacement<br>There are a number of reasons house owners might need to consider changing their soffit and fascia:<br>Damage from Weather: Storms, hail, and heavy rains can harm [https://bestbizportal.com/read-blog/472725 Soffit Board Repair] and fascia, leading to wear and tear and compromised structural integrity.Pest Infestation: Rodents, insects, and birds may find their method into damaged soffits, leading to infestations that can damage the home.Rot and Decay: Wooden soffits or fascia are especially prone to rot when exposed to wetness, causing a requirement for replacement.Climate Adaptation: Homeowners might choose to change soffit and fascia to better suit their regional environment, selecting materials that stand up to severe climate condition.Visual Upgrade: Aging or outdated soffit and fascia can detract from a home's curb appeal, triggering house owners to purchase an upgrade.Table 2: Signs You Need to Replace Soffit and FasciaSignDescriptionVisible DeteriorationFractures, rot, or falling pieces appear.Bug ActivitySigns of rodents or insects near the roofline.Moisture ProblemsMold or mildew in the attic or near roofing system locations.Poor Air CirculationIncreased energy costs due to ventilation problems.StainingFading colors or stains on the soffit/fascia.The Replacement Process<br>Changing soffit and fascia might seem difficult, but with correct preparation, it can be a straightforward project. Below is a step-by-step guide to the replacement procedure:<br>Step 1: Assess the Structure<br>Before starting any [https://graph.org/The-No-1-Question-That-Everyone-In-Upvc-Soffit-Must-Know-How-To-Answer-11-17 Replacement Fascia Boards], it is important to examine the condition of the existing soffit and fascia. Determine the extent of the damage and whether any underlying structural problems need attending to.<br>Action 2: Choose Replacement Materials<br>Select materials that best match your home's needs and environment. Common soffit and fascia products include:<br>Vinyl: Low-maintenance and resistant to moisture and pests.Aluminum: Lightweight with outstanding toughness and insulation residential or commercial properties.Wood: Traditional and aesthetically enticing however needs routine maintenance.Action 3: Gather Tools and Materials<br>Ensure you have the following tools and products on hand:<br>LadderSafety safety glassesHammerNail weaponEnergy knifeMeasuring tapeNew soffit and fascia materialsFastenersStep 4: Remove Old Material<br>Carefully remove the old soffit and fascia, making sure not to harm surrounding areas. It's necessary to wear protective gear during this procedure.<br>Step 5: Install New Soffit and Fascia<br>Begin by installing the new fascia board at the roofing system's edge, ensuring it's protected with proper fasteners. Next, install the soffit panels, starting from one end and working your way to the other, making sure correct spacing for ventilation where required.<br>Step 6: Cleanup and Final Touches<br>Once installation is total, clean up any particles and make certain all tools are put away. It's likewise an excellent chance to repaint or finish the soffit and fascia to boost their look.<br>Table 3: Average Costs of Soffit and Fascia ReplacementMaterial TypeRate per square footEstimated Total for 1,000 sqftVinyl₤ 2 - ₤ 5₤ 2,000 - ₤ 5,000Aluminum₤ 3 - ₤ 6₤ 3,000 - ₤ 6,000Wood₤ 4 - ₤ 8₤ 4,000 - ₤ 8,000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: How often should soffit and fascia be changed?<br>A1: It differs depending on products and environment conditions. Typically, you should inspect them every 5-10 years for any signs of wear.<br>Q2: Can I replace soffit and fascia myself?<br>A2: While it's possible for useful homeowners, the installation can be tough. If you are not comfy working at heights or absence experience, working with a professional is advised.<br>Q3: What are the benefits of utilizing vinyl over wood for soffit and fascia?<br>A3: Vinyl is more resistant to moisture and bugs and requires less maintenance compared to wood, which is susceptible to rot and needs regular treatment.<br>Q4: Will replacing soffit and fascia enhance my home's energy performance?<br>A4: Yes, correct ventilation from a brand-new soffit can enhance airflow in the attic, possibly minimizing cooling and heating costs.<br>Q5: How can I keep my new soffit and fascia?<br>A5: Regularly inspect for any damage, tidy seamless gutters to prevent overflow, and wash vinyl or aluminum surface areas to prevent accumulation.<br><br>[http://soumoli.com/home.php?mod=space&uid=1035579 Soffit and fascia replacement] is an often-overlooked yet vital aspect of home maintenance.
